GREENVILLE, Pa. (Feb. 4) – The Waynesburg University men's wrestling team concluded both the Presidents' Athletic and dual match portions when it traveled to Thiel on Wednesday. The Yellow Jackets fell 46-9 to the Tomcats.

Jessie Orbin (Houston, Pa. / Chartiers-Houston) continued his outstanding junior season with a pin in 1:04 over Tony Ceriani at 174 pounds. With the win, Orbin completed his second-straight undefeated dual schedule and ran his current winning streak to 15 bouts. He improved to 22-2 on the season.

AJ Tomaino (Bethel Park, Pa. / Bethel Park made it two wins in a row for the Jackets (1-10, 0-5) by hitting a late takedown to win a closely-contested 8-6 decision over Zach Ward at 184 pounds.
Thiel closed the match with wins at 197 pounds and heavyweight.
